Comment(by malb):

 Replying to [comment:14 drkirkby]:

 > A few questions:
 > * Has there been an agreement to add this library? If so, can you
 provide a link to it.

 No decision on [sage-devel] has happened yet. However, the Sage developers
 here at Sage Days 24 seem to be in favour of adding it.

 > * Why is it not in another package, rather than added to the libm4ri
 package?

 It makes maintaining the thing easier for all sides: I'm the maintainer of
 both libraries for both upstream and the SPKGs. It isn't even decided yet
 whether the two libraries might get merged in the future. Finally, William
 asked me to not add a new SPKG but to add the M4RIe extension to the M4RI
 package.
